How to Make Loaded Chicken Taco Salad with Creamy Lime-Cilantro Dressing
Now that we have our ingredients ready, let’s get cooking! This is where the magic happens. I’ll walk you through each step, ensuring your Loaded Chicken Taco Salad with Creamy Lime-Cilantro Dressing turns out perfect every time.
Step 1: Cook the Chicken
In a large skillet, pour in the olive oil. Once heated, add your chicken pieces. Make sure they’re evenly coated with 1 heaping tablespoon of taco seasoning. Cook the chicken over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es, flipping occasionally. This helps them brown nicely and absorb those delicious taco flavors. The goal is to reach a juicy tenderness. Once done, let the chicken rest off the heat for the flavors to settle.
Step 2: Assemble the Salad
Take a large platter and arrange the romaine lettuce as your base. This provides a nice, crunchy foundation. Next, layer on the diced tomatoes, corn, black beans, and avocado. Each ingredient adds a splash of color and flavor, making the salad a feast for the eyes. Sprinkle the shredded cheese over the top, letting it melt slightly from the warmth of the chicken. Finally, add the crushed tortilla chips for that irresistible crunch. Isn’t it gorgeous already?
Step 3: Prepare the Dressing
In a small bowl, combine the mayonnaise and sour cream. Stir in the yummy lime juice and the remaining taco seasoning. Whisk until blended beautifully. Add the minced cilantro, with its fresh aroma enhancing the mix. If you like your dressing a bit thinner, feel free to add an extra splash of lime juice. Taste it, and if you find it too tangy, sprinkle in a bit of sugar. It’s all about that balance!
Step 4: Combine and Serve
To bring everything together, drizzle your creamy lime-cilantro dressing generously over the layered salad. Give it a gentle toss if you like, but it looks stunning left as is! Serve it up immediately for the freshest experience. I love to accompany it with a side of extra tortilla chips or a zesty lime wedge for squeezing. Tips for Success
- Use a meat thermometer to ensure chicken is cooked to 165°F for safety.
- Chill the dressing for added flavor before drizzling it over the salad.
- Feel free to mix and match your favorite toppings to cater to everyone’s taste.
- Prep ingredients ahead of time to minimize cooking stress on busy nights.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container to keep everything fresh for the next day!

FAQs about Loaded Chicken Taco Salad with Creamy Lime-Cilantro Dressing
Have questions about this delicious Loaded Chicken Taco Salad with Creamy Lime-Cilantro Dressing? I’m here to help! Here’s a quick rundown of some common queries that might pop into your mind.
Can I make the dressing 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can whip up the creamy lime-cilantro dressing a day in advance. Just store it in the fridge and give it a good stir before serving.
Can I use different types of lettuce?
Sure! While romaine is a sturdy choice, you can also try iceberg or baby spinach for a milder flavor. Each brings its own crunch and freshness to the salad!
How can I adapt this recipe for meal prep?
This Loaded Chicken Taco Salad is perfect for meal prep! Just keep the lettuce and dressing separate until serving to retain freshness. Divide the rest of the ingredients into containers for easy lunches.
Is this recipe suitable for my gluten-free diet?
You’re in luck! This taco salad is gluten-free as long as you use gluten-free tortilla chips. Always check labels to ensure all ingredients meet your dietary needs.
Can I use leftovers in a different dish?
Definitely! Leftover salad ingredients can be transformed into burritos, tacos, or even a tasty quesadilla filling. Don’t let anything go to waste!

Description
A flavorful Loaded Chicken Taco Salad topped with a creamy lime-cilantro dressing, perfect for a satisfying meal.
- In a large skillet, add the olive oil, chicken, and evenly sprinkle with 1 heaping tablespoon taco seasoning. Cook over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es, flipping intermittently.
- Allow the chicken to rest in the pan off the heat while you assemble the salad.
- On a large platter, add the lettuce and then evenly sprinkle with the tomatoes, corn, black beans, avocado, cheese, tortilla chips, and chicken; set aside.
- In a small bowl, add the mayo, sour cream, lime juice, and 1 heaping tablespoon taco seasoning. Whisk to combine.
- Add the cilantro and stir to incorporate. Add additional lime juice to thin out the dressing if desired.
- Taste the dressing and, depending on how much lime juice was used, add sugar to taste. Evenly drizzle the dressing over the salad.
Notes
- For a healthier option, you can use lite mayo and Greek yogurt.
- Adjust the amount of lime juice based on your taste preference.
- The dressing can be adjusted with or without sugar depending on your preference.
